## Understanding E-Bike Batteries

Before diving into the charging process, it’s essential to understand the types of batteries commonly used in e-bikes. The battery is the heart of your e-bike, providing the power needed for the motor to assist your pedaling or, in some cases, to propel the bike entirely. Different battery types have different charging requirements and lifecycles.

### Lithium-Ion (Li-Ion) Batteries

* **Most Common:** Lithium-ion batteries are the most prevalent type used in e-bikes due to their high energy density, relatively light weight, and longer lifespan compared to older battery technologies.
* **Charging Characteristics:** Li-Ion batteries prefer shallow discharges and frequent charging. Unlike older nickel-cadmium (NiCd) batteries, they don’t develop a “memory effect,” meaning you don’t need to fully discharge them before recharging.
* **Lifespan:** Typically, a well-maintained Li-Ion e-bike battery can last for 500-1000 charge cycles, depending on the quality of the battery and how it’s used and charged.

### Lithium Polymer (Li-Po) Batteries

* **Similar to Li-Ion:** Li-Po batteries are a subtype of lithium-ion batteries. They are known for their flexibility in terms of shape and size, making them suitable for various e-bike designs.
* **Performance:** They offer similar performance characteristics to Li-Ion batteries, including high energy density and no memory effect.
* **Care:** Li-Po batteries generally require more careful handling than standard Li-Ion batteries, particularly during charging. Overcharging or discharging too deeply can damage them.

### Nickel-Metal Hydride (NiMH) Batteries

* **Less Common:** NiMH batteries are less common in newer e-bikes but may be found in older models. They offer a higher energy density than NiCd batteries but are less efficient than Li-Ion batteries.
* **Environmental Friendliness:** NiMH batteries are generally considered more environmentally friendly than NiCd batteries because they don’t contain toxic cadmium.
* **Maintenance:** NiMH batteries can suffer from a memory effect if not properly maintained, so occasional full discharge cycles are recommended.

### Lead-Acid Batteries

* **Heavier and Less Efficient:** Lead-acid batteries are the oldest type of rechargeable battery and are rarely used in modern e-bikes due to their heavy weight, lower energy density, and shorter lifespan.
* **Cost-Effective (Initially):** They are cheaper to produce, which is why they might be found in some very low-cost e-bikes.
* **Charging:** Lead-acid batteries require careful charging to avoid overcharging, which can damage them.

## Preparing to Charge Your E-Bike

Before you plug in your e-bike, take a few moments to prepare. Proper preparation ensures safety and helps prolong the life of your battery.

### 1. Read the Manual

* **Importance:** This is the most crucial step. Your e-bike’s manual contains specific instructions and recommendations for charging your particular model. Ignoring these instructions can void your warranty or even damage the battery.
* **Key Information:** Look for information on the recommended charging voltage, charging time, and any specific precautions you should take.

### 2. Check the Battery and Charger

* **Visual Inspection:** Examine the battery and charger for any signs of damage, such as cracks, frayed wires, or loose connections. Do not attempt to charge a damaged battery or use a damaged charger.
* **Compatibility:** Ensure that the charger is the correct one for your e-bike battery. Using the wrong charger can lead to overcharging or undercharging, both of which can damage the battery.

### 3. Find a Suitable Charging Location

* **Indoor Charging:** Charge your e-bike battery indoors in a well-ventilated area. Avoid charging in direct sunlight, extreme temperatures, or humid environments.
* **Fire Safety:** Place the battery on a non-flammable surface, away from flammable materials. Have a fire extinguisher nearby as a precaution.
* **Accessibility:** Choose a location where you can easily monitor the charging process.

### 4. Turn Off the E-Bike

* **Power Down:** Ensure that the e-bike is completely turned off before charging. This prevents any accidental discharge during the charging process and protects the battery.
* **Remove the Key (If Applicable):** If your e-bike has a key switch, remove the key to prevent accidental activation.

## Step-by-Step Guide to Charging Your E-Bike

Now that you’ve prepared your e-bike and charging area, follow these steps to charge your battery safely and effectively.

### 1. Locate the Charging Port

* **Battery On-Bike:** If you’re charging the battery while it’s still mounted on the e-bike, the charging port is usually located on the battery itself or near the motor.
* **Battery Removed:** If you’ve removed the battery, the charging port will be on the battery pack.
* **Covered Port:** The charging port may be covered by a rubber or plastic cap to protect it from dirt and moisture. Remove the cap before plugging in the charger.

### 2. Connect the Charger to the Battery

* **Proper Alignment:** Align the charger connector with the charging port on the battery. Do not force the connector; it should fit easily.
* **Secure Connection:** Ensure that the connector is securely plugged into the charging port. A loose connection can lead to inefficient charging or even damage to the battery and charger.

### 3. Plug the Charger into the Power Outlet

* **Voltage Compatibility:** Make sure the power outlet matches the voltage requirements of the charger. Using an incompatible voltage can damage the charger and potentially create a fire hazard.
* **Grounding:** Use a grounded outlet for safety. If you’re unsure whether an outlet is grounded, consult an electrician.
* **Avoid Extension Cords (If Possible):** If possible, plug the charger directly into the wall outlet. If you must use an extension cord, make sure it’s heavy-duty and in good condition.

### 4. Monitor the Charging Process

* **Indicator Lights:** The charger will typically have indicator lights to show the charging status. These lights may indicate:
* **Charging:** A red or orange light usually indicates that the battery is charging.
* **Fully Charged:** A green light or a change in color indicates that the battery is fully charged.
* **Error:** A flashing light or an unusual color may indicate an error, such as a faulty battery or charger.
* **Charging Time:** Refer to your e-bike’s manual for the recommended charging time. Charging times can vary depending on the battery capacity and the charger’s output.
* **Don’t Overcharge:** Once the battery is fully charged, disconnect the charger from the power outlet and the battery. Overcharging can damage the battery and reduce its lifespan.

### 5. Disconnect the Charger

* **Unplug from the Outlet First:** Always unplug the charger from the power outlet before disconnecting it from the battery. This prevents any electrical surges that could damage the battery.
* **Remove the Connector:** Gently remove the connector from the charging port on the battery. Avoid pulling on the cord.
* **Replace the Port Cover:** If the charging port has a cover, replace it to protect the port from dirt and moisture.

## Charging Tips for Optimal Battery Life

Following these tips can help you maximize the lifespan and performance of your e-bike battery.

### 1. Partial Charging is Preferable

* **Li-Ion Advantage:** Unlike older battery technologies, Li-Ion batteries don’t need to be fully discharged before recharging. In fact, partial charging is often better for their longevity.
* **Top Up Regularly:** Consider topping up the battery after each ride, even if it’s not completely depleted. This keeps the battery within its optimal charge range.

### 2. Avoid Deep Discharges

* **Stress on the Battery:** Deeply discharging the battery (i.e., running it down to 0%) puts stress on the battery cells and can shorten its lifespan.
* **Recharge Before Empty:** Try to recharge the battery when it still has at least 20-30% of its capacity remaining.

### 3. Store the Battery Properly

* **Ideal Conditions:** Store the battery in a cool, dry place, away from direct sunlight and extreme temperatures.
* **Partial Charge for Storage:** If you’re storing the battery for an extended period, charge it to around 40-60% before storing it. This prevents the battery from self-discharging too much.
* **Regular Check-Ups:** Check the battery periodically during storage and top it up if necessary.

### 4. Use the Correct Charger

* **Manufacturer’s Recommendation:** Always use the charger that came with your e-bike or a charger specifically recommended by the manufacturer. Using an incompatible charger can damage the battery.
* **Avoid Generic Chargers:** Generic chargers may not provide the correct voltage and current, which can lead to overcharging or undercharging.

### 5. Avoid Extreme Temperatures

* **Heat and Cold:** Extreme temperatures can negatively impact battery performance and lifespan. Avoid charging or storing the battery in temperatures below freezing or above 100°F (38°C).
* **Cool Down Before Charging:** If you’ve just ridden your e-bike in hot weather, let the battery cool down before charging it.

### 6. Clean the Battery Terminals

* **Corrosion:** Over time, the battery terminals can become corroded, which can affect the charging efficiency.
* **Cleaning Solution:** Clean the terminals with a soft cloth and a small amount of rubbing alcohol or a specialized battery terminal cleaner.
* **Preventative Measures:** Apply a thin layer of dielectric grease to the terminals to prevent future corrosion.

### 7. Consider a Smart Charger

* **Advanced Features:** Smart chargers have advanced features that can optimize the charging process and protect the battery.
* **Automatic Shut-Off:** They automatically shut off when the battery is fully charged, preventing overcharging.
* **Maintenance Mode:** Some smart chargers have a maintenance mode that can help maintain the battery’s health during storage.

## Troubleshooting Common Charging Issues

Even with proper care, you may encounter some issues while charging your e-bike. Here are some common problems and how to troubleshoot them.

### 1. Battery Not Charging

* **Check the Connections:** Make sure that the charger is securely plugged into both the battery and the power outlet.
* **Test the Outlet:** Test the power outlet with another device to ensure that it’s working.
* **Inspect the Charger:** Check the charger for any signs of damage, such as frayed wires or loose connections.
* **Check the Battery Fuse:** Some e-bike batteries have a fuse that can blow if there’s a power surge. Check the fuse and replace it if necessary.
* **Battery Management System (BMS):** Some batteries have a BMS that may shut down the battery if it detects a problem. Consult your e-bike’s manual for instructions on how to reset the BMS.

### 2. Charger Not Indicating Charging

* **Charger Failure:** The charger itself may be faulty. Try using a different charger that you know is working.
* **Battery Issue:** The battery may be damaged or have reached the end of its lifespan. If the battery is old, it may need to be replaced.

### 3. Slow Charging

* **Low Voltage Outlet:** A low voltage outlet can cause the battery to charge slowly. Try using a different outlet.
* **Charger Output:** The charger may have a low output. Check the charger’s specifications and compare it to the battery’s requirements.
* **Temperature:** Extreme temperatures can slow down the charging process. Charge the battery in a moderate temperature environment.

### 4. Battery Overheating

* **Ventilation:** Make sure the battery is well-ventilated during charging. Avoid covering the battery or charger.
* **Faulty Battery:** An overheating battery may be a sign of a more serious problem. Discontinue charging and consult a qualified technician.
* **Charger Compatibility:** Ensure that you are using the correct charger for your battery. Using an incompatible charger can cause overheating.

### 5. Error Codes

* **Consult the Manual:** If the charger displays an error code, consult your e-bike’s manual for troubleshooting instructions.
* **Contact Support:** If you can’t resolve the issue yourself, contact the e-bike manufacturer or a qualified technician for assistance.

## Safety Precautions

* **Never Leave Charging Unattended:** It’s best to monitor the charging process and not leave it unattended for extended periods, especially overnight.
* **Smoke Detectors:** Ensure you have working smoke detectors in your home, particularly near where you charge your e-bike.
* **Fire Extinguisher:** Keep a fire extinguisher nearby in case of a fire.
* **Avoid Modifying the Battery or Charger:** Do not attempt to modify the battery or charger in any way. This can be dangerous and void the warranty.
* **Dispose of Batteries Properly:** When the battery reaches the end of its lifespan, dispose of it properly according to local regulations. Do not throw it in the trash.
